摘要
Six new ammine/dimethylamine platinum(II) complexes with carboxylates (a similar to f) have been synthesized and characterized by elemental analysis, conductivity, thermal analysis, IR, UV, and H-1 NMR techniques. The cytotoxicity of the complexes was tested by MTT (3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yl tetrazolium bromide) assay. The levels of total platinum bound to DNA were measured by ICP-MS. The results show that the complexes (a-f) have selectivity against tested carcinomas, have no cytotoxicity against HCT-8, BGC-823 and MCF-7 but have better cytotoxicity against EJ and HL-60, moreover, cytotoxicity of complexes (d-f) against HL-60 is similar to that of cisplatin. The levels of total platinum bound to DNA in HL-60 are increased with increasing concentrations, and the levels of total platinum bound to DNA increase in the following sequence: cisplatin < C < b < a < f < e < d.
